Description (What the record is about)
-
British Railways' Southern Region marine records, principally voyage reports on the services to the Channel Islands, Le Havre, and St. Malo. The series also includes minutes and agenda papers for the Annual and Board meetings of Societe Anonyme de Navigation Angleterre-Lorraine-Alsace, 1953 to 1961.
